AlfredSisley(/ssli/French:[sisl]30October183929
January1899)wasanImpressionistlandscapepainterwho
wasbornandspentmostofhislifeinFrance,butretained
Britishcitizenship.Hewasthemostconsistentofthe
Impressionistsinhisdedicationtopaintinglandscapeen
pleinair(i.e.,outdoors).Hedeviatedintofigurepainting
onlyrarelyand,unlikeRenoirandPissarro,foundthat
Impressionismfulfilledhisartisticneeds.

Amonghisimportantworksareaseriesofpaintingsofthe
RiverThames,mostlyaroundHamptonCourt,executedin
1874,andlandscapesdepictingplacesinornearMoretsur
Loing.ThenotablepaintingsoftheSeineanditsbridgesin
theformersuburbsofParisarelikemanyofhislandscapes,
characterizedbytranquillity,inpaleshadesofgreen,pink,
purple,dustyblueandcream.OvertheyearsSisley'spower
ofexpressionandcolorintensityincreased.[1]

In1870theFrancoPrussianWarbegan,andasaresultSisley'sfather'sbusinessfailedandthepainter'ssole
meansofsupportbecamethesaleofhisworks.Fortheremainderofhislifehewouldliveinpoverty,ashis
paintingsdidnotrisesignificantlyinmonetaryvalueuntilafterhisdeath.[3]Occasionally,however,Sisley
wouldbebackedbypatronsandthisallowedhim,amongotherthings,tomakeafewbrieftripstoBritain.
Thefirstoftheseoccurredin1874afterthefirstindependentImpressionistexhibition.Theresultofafew
monthsspentnearLondonwasaseriesofnearlytwentypaintingsoftheUpperThamesnearMolesey,which
waslaterdescribedbyarthistorianKennethClarkas"aperfectmomentofImpressionism."
Until1880,SisleylivedandworkedinthecountrywestofParisthenheandhisfamilymovedtoasmall
villagenearMoretsurLoing,closetotheforestofFontainebleau,wherethepaintersoftheBarbizonschool
hadworkedearlierinthecentury.Here,asarthistorianAnnePoulethassaid,"thegentlelandscapeswiththeir
constantlychangingatmospherewereperfectlyattunedtohistalents.UnlikeMonet,heneversoughtthedrama
oftherampagingoceanorthebrilliantlycoloredsceneryoftheCted'Azur."[4]
In1881SisleymadeasecondbriefvoyagetoBritain.
In1897SisleyandhispartnervisitedBritainagain,andwerefinallymarriedinCardiffRegisterOfficeon5
August.[5]TheystayedatPenarth,whereSisleypaintedatleastsixoilsoftheseaandthecliffs.InmidAugust
theymovedtotheOsborneHotelatLanglandBayontheGowerPeninsula,whereheproducedatleasteleven
oilpaintingsinandaroundLanglandBayandRothersladeBay(thencalledLady'sCove).Theyreturnedto
FranceinOctober.ThiswasSisley'slastvoyagetohisancestralhomeland.TheNationalMuseumCardiff
possessestwoofhisoilpaintingsofPenarthandLangland.
ThefollowingyearSisleyappliedforFrenchcitizenship,butwasrefused.Asecondapplicationwasmadeand
supportedbyapolicereport,butillnessintervened,[6]andSisleyremainedBritishtillhisdeath.
Thepainterdiedon29January1899inMoretsurLoingattheageof59,afewmonthsafterthedeathofhis
wife.
Work
Sisley'sstudentworksarelost.Hisfirstlandscapepaintingsaresombre,colouredwithdarkbrowns,greens,and
paleblues.TheywereoftenexecutedatMarlyandSaintCloud.LittleisknownaboutSisley'srelationshipwith
thepaintingsofJ.M.W.TurnerandJohnConstable,whichhemayhaveseeninLondon,butsomehave

AmongtheImpressionists,Sisleyhasbeenovershadowedby
Monet,whoseworkhisresemblesinstyleandsubjectmatter,
althoughSisley'seffectsaremoresubdued.[8]Describedbyart
historianRobertRosenblumashaving"almostagenericcharacter,
animpersonaltextbookideaofaperfectImpressionistpainting",[9]
hisworkstronglyinvokesatmosphere,andhisskiesarealways
impressive.Heconcentratedonlandscapemoreconsistentlythan
anyotherImpressionistpainter.

AmongSisley'sbestknownworksareStreetinMoretandSand
Heaps,bothownedbytheArtInstituteofChicago,andTheBridge
atMoretsurLoing,shownatMused'Orsay,Paris.Alledes
peupliersdeMoret(TheLaneofPoplarsatMoret)hasbeenstolen
threetimesfromtheMusedesBeauxArtsinNiceoncein1978
whenonloaninMarseilles(recoveredafewdayslaterinthecity's
sewers),againin1998(whenthemuseum'scuratorwasconvicted
ofthetheftandjailedforfiveyearswithtwoaccomplices)and
finallyinAugust2007(on4June2008Frenchpolicerecoveredit
andthreeotherstolenpaintingsfromavaninMarseilles).[10]
AlargenumberoffakeSisleyshavebeendiscovered.Sisley
producedsome900oilpaintings,some100pastelsandmanyother
drawings,althoughheonlylivedtobe59yearsold.[11]
